inZOI's Upcoming Karma System and Ghost Zois: A Glimpse into the Afterlife
inZOI game director Hyungjun Kim recently revealed intriguing details about an upcoming Karma system, introducing a paranormal element to the game's realistic simulation of life. This system will determine the fate of deceased Zois, transforming them into ghosts based on their accumulated Karma points.
High Karma Zois will transition to the afterlife, while those with insufficient points remain as ghosts, bound to the mortal realm until they atone for their actions. The specific methods for restoring Karma points remain undisclosed.
Kim assures players that ghost interactions will be carefully balanced to avoid overshadowing core gameplay, offering engaging encounters under specific circumstances. In the Early Access version, these interactions will be limited to special conversations at designated times.
While inZOI prioritizes realism, Kim expressed interest in exploring more fantastical elements, suggesting the Karma system is a first step into this direction. He views this as a way to enhance the game's simulation of life's complexities.
A Sneak Peek at Karma Interactions
A sponsored video by content creator MadMorph offered a brief preview of the Karma Interaction system. This system allows Zois to perform actions that impact their Karma score, both positively and negatively. The video showcased a humorous example of a negative interaction (secretly farting on another Zoi), while positive actions like recycling or liking a friend's post were mentioned but not demonstrated.
While the Early Access release (March 28, 2025 on Steam) will focus on the living Zois, the Karma Interaction system promises to significantly impact future gameplay.
